Output 43213003d538c38d54395468eaa631602393cc4e08169243a357f4e4ada8aefe:1

value
821969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c868d3f92401e333e70008771bfe1abcb0206db4 OP_EQUAL
address
3KxgeVHAWoPZj1sqCtzjWjKmqiMvYQ4qDE
transaction
43213003d538c38d54395468eaa631602393cc4e08169243a357f4e4ada8aefe
spent
true